Ok this is a topic I know quite a bit about...
If they don't total it. Tell them you want "DIMINSHMENT OF VALUE" paid to you.
This is the difference between what the car is worth pre-loss vs. repaired.
A rule of thumb is 1/2-2/3 the price of the repairs.
The insurance company WILL push back and say no. You then need to hire a cheap as dirt attorney and sue the lady who hit you; not the insurance company. (she will be covered by the insurance company by default)
Instead of going to court, the insurance company will pay 9-10 times.
Tell them you want 100% of the cost of the repairs paid to you as "diminishment of value".
Also, it doesn't hurt to throw in "I can't sleep since the wreck, and I need viagra...."
Most likely they will offer 1/2-2/3 the cost of repairs. That is the usual and customery amount.
